BREAKING: Hegseth Chief of Staff Joe Kasper OUT at Pentagon

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th’s Chief of Staff Joe Kasper will leave his position at the Pentagon after three other Hegseth aides were fired last week.

Last week it was reported that Joe Kasper was going to take another job at the Defense Department amid a shakeup at the Pentagon after a probe into leaks.

Politico reported:

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th’s controversial chief of staff, who played a central role in a power struggle that gripped the Pentagon, will exit the agency today.

Joe Kasper was originally expected to transition to another role within the Defense Department, but is now planning to go back to government relations and consulting, he said in an interview.

He will continue to support and advise the Pentagon, he said, but as a special government employee. This will limit him to performing temporary jobs for just 130 days a year.

Joe Kasper reportedly had a “deep vendetta” against the the three men who parted ways, Fox News reported.

Kasper spearheaded the probe into the leaks to reporters.

“This is not about interpersonal conflict,” a Pentagon official told Fox News. “There is evidence of leaking. This is about unauthorized disclosures, up to and including classified information.”
